genagelt
Genagelt is the past participle form of the German verb nageln, meaning to nail. In usage, genagelt functions as both a verbal participle and as an adjective describing something that has been secured with nails. The term literally translates to “nailed” and is most often encountered in technical or descriptive contexts related to carpentry and construction.
